BitShares Forum

Main => Technical Support => Topic started by: mostar on October 16, 2015, 01:13:56 pm

Title: Import to V2 moonstone wallet backup
Post by: mostar on October 16, 2015, 01:13:56 pm
Hi,

Those who participate in moonstone crowd funding receive V1 backup wallet with the founds.

Restore this wallet  in 0.9.3 and
Code: [Select]
wallet_export_keys ...
End with  json file that not contain any account key:

Quote
{
  "password_checksum": "c10....5a59fa",
  "account_keys": []
}

The moonstone backup wallet is file, I successfully restored it in the past for checking.

How can I import the those found to V2?

Thanks
Title: Re: Import to V2 moonstone wallet backup
Post by: mostar on December 18, 2015, 10:52:53 am
Im I the only one how have this problem?
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on December 18, 2015, 12:46:09 pm
Does the original file contain any keys or is there may a brainkey? I never took a closer look into that format and can't look into any of them either now
Title: Re: Import to V2 moonstone wallet backup
Post by: mostar on January 25, 2016, 02:33:30 pm
Hello

Here it is without the HEX charcters

file name:
wallet_data_BTS....json

Quote
[{"type":"master_key_record_type","data":{"index":-1,"encrypted_key":"3..."}},{"type":"key_record_type","data":{"index":1,"account_address":"B...","encrypted_private_key":"d...","valid_from_signature":false,"memo":null,"gen_seq_number":0}},{"type":"account_record_type","data":{"index":2,"id":0,"name":"moonstonefunds","public_data":null,"owner_key":"B...","active_key_history":[["2015-04-10T06:46:43","B..."]],"registration_date":"1970-01-01T00:00:00","last_update":"2015-04-10T06:46:43","delegate_info":null,"meta_data":null,"is_my_account":true,"approved":0,"is_favorite":false,"block_production_enabled":false,"last_used_gen_sequence":0,"private_data":null}}

I can import it to old 0.9 wallet with no problem.  But how can I import those found to bitshare 2?

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on January 25, 2016, 02:53:03 pm
I think all you need to do is import the wallet into BitShares 0.9.3c first and then export a new wallet backup ..
that should leave you with a new json file that you can import into bts2
Title: Re: Import to V2 moonstone wallet backup
Post by: mostar on January 26, 2016, 04:19:04 pm
As you suggested I restored this wallet in 0.9.3 and
Code: [Select]
wallet_export_keys ...Like it documented here http://docs.bitshares.eu/bitshares/migration/howto-exporting-wallet.html (http://docs.bitshares.eu/bitshares/migration/howto-exporting-wallet.html)

I end with  json file that not contain any account key:

Quote
{
  "password_checksum": "c10....5a59fa",
  "account_keys": []
}

The moonstone backup wallet is fine, I successfully restored it in the past for checking.

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on January 27, 2016, 06:26:45 am
So,
a) you can import the moonstone file into bts 0.9.3c
b) you see the balance once you have it imported
c) if you export your wallet again, you get empty account keys?

if so, in which account do you see your MOONFUND tokens?
Maybe it is related to the tokens not being tied to a REGISTERED account, if that is the case I know what to do.
As long as you can see your MOONFUND in bts0.9.3c, we can import them into BTS2 eventually .. may be a little more tricky than what is explained in the migration guide
Title: Re: Import to V2 moonstone wallet backup
Post by: mostar on January 27, 2016, 05:26:13 pm
Hi,

Quote
a) you can import the moonstone file into bts 0.9.3c
yes
Quote
b) you see the balance once you have it imported
no, back in the past when I check it in bts 0.9 I show the balance. But now in fresh new install of 0.9.3c there is no balance.
Here is a screen shut
(http://s27.postimg.org/dlnnmlv1b/Selection_009.jpg) (http://postimg.org/image/dlnnmlv1b/)

Quote
c) if you export your wallet again, you get empty account keys?
yes

Quote
if so, in which account do you see your MOONFUND tokens?
It was not associate to any account

Quote
As long as you can see your MOONFUND in bts0.9.3c, we can import them into BTS2 eventually .. may be a little more tricky than what is explained in the migration guide

Please give me directions
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on January 29, 2016, 08:11:54 pm
i am quite certain that you need to rescync tge whole blockchain to catch your funds (due to TITAN) .. once you see your funds you can export a wallet and import into bts
Title: Re: Import to V2 moonstone wallet backup
Post by: mostar on February 01, 2016, 05:53:07 am
you need to rescync tge whole blockchain to catch your funds (due to TITAN) .. once you see your funds you can export a wallet and import into bts

But what abut account, I install 0.9.3c and import the backup wallet. I don't have account on the old system?!

Where can I find instaction regarding: sync the whole blockchain on 0.9.3c?

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on February 01, 2016, 08:12:13 am
I never donated to MOONFUND, so I can't say how it was supposed to be working. My assumption was that the funds are imported in an unregistered local wallet account name.
All I can recommend from here on is to contact the devs of moonstone.io directly. Sorry
Title: Re: Import to V2 moonstone wallet backup
Post by: bitsapphire on February 01, 2016, 04:31:07 pm
If you haven't traded any of the moonunds just keep the backup wallet file you automatically downloaded when you donated.

If you acquired moonfund tokens by trading, or traded your moonfund tokens after you got them through the fundraiser, export your latest wallet file from 2.0 and keep it somewhere safe. Once we release the wallet you'll be able to import the same wallet files np problem.
Title: Re: Import to V2 moonstone wallet backup
Post by: Harvey on February 25, 2016, 07:04:32 am
Hope everything is going well in the Moonstone project.
Title: Re: Import to V2 moonstone wallet backup
Post by: abit on March 16, 2016, 01:40:02 am
you need to rescync tge whole blockchain to catch your funds (due to TITAN) .. once you see your funds you can export a wallet and import into bts

But what abut account, I install 0.9.3c and import the backup wallet. I don't have account on the old system?!

Where can I find instaction regarding: sync the whole blockchain on 0.9.3c?
You need: install, import key, sync, rescan.
A tutorial is here: https://bitsharestalk.org/index.php/topic,20822.0.html
There are download links of whole 0.9.3 blockchain in that post: https://mega.nz/#!P8BhCZ4I!NZHkhUEbrgVTNRI1QXhDJI6ly7z1Fv2nFgrpQM1UWDQ
Title: Re: Import to V2 moonstone wallet backup
Post by: xeroc on March 16, 2016, 07:30:51 am
Also:
http://bitshares.eu/blog/2016/03/14/BitShares-0.9.3-full-blockchain/